diff --git a/src/json/default_shellRunner.json b/src/json/default_shellRunner.json index d9d405e..1c06af5 100644 --- a/src/json/default_shellRunner.json +++ b/src/json/default_shellRunner.json @@ -1,23 +1,15 @@ -{ - "features": { - "code": "default_shellRunner", - "explain": "执行 shell 命令", - "cmds": [ - "sh" - ], - "icon": "", - "platform": [ - "win32", - "darwin", - "linux" - ] - }, - "program": "quickcommand", - "cmd": "const iconv = require('iconv-lite')\nvar child = child_process.spawn(`{{subinput}}`, {shell: true, encoding: 'buffer'})\n\nchild.stdout.on('data', data => {\n var codec = utools.isWindows() ? 'cp936' : 'utf8'\n console.log(iconv.decode(data, codec))\n})\n\nchild.stderr.on('data', data => {\n var codec = utools.isWindows() ? 'cp936' : 'utf8'\n console.error(iconv.decode(data, codec))\n})", - "output": "text", - "hasSubInput": true, - "scptarg": "", - "tags": [ - "默认" - ] -} +{ + "program": "quickcommand", + "cmd": "const iconv = require('iconv-lite')\nconst child_process = require(\"child_process\")\nvar child = child_process.spawn(`{{subinput}}`, {shell: true, encoding: 'buffer'})\n\nchild.stdout.on('data', data => {\n var codec = utools.isWindows() ? 'cp936' : 'utf8'\n console.log(iconv.decode(data, codec))\n})\n\nchild.stderr.on('data', data => {\n var codec = utools.isWindows() ? 'cp936' : 'utf8'\n console.error(iconv.decode(data, codec))\n})", + "scptarg": "", + "features": { + "explain": "执行 shell 命令", + "platform": ["win32", "darwin", "linux"], + "icon": "", + "code": "default_shellRunner", + "cmds": ["sh"] + }, + "output": "text", + "hasSubInput": true, + "tags": ["默认"] +}